What is Wi-Fi Direct and why is it better than Miracast or DLNA?
Wi-Fi Direct is a wireless standard that allows devices (such as a laptop and TV) to connect directly as if they were on the same network. Unlike:
- 🔄 Miracast - requires support on both devices and often lags at high resolutions;
- 📡 DLNA — transmits only media files (photos, videos), but not the entire screen;
- 🔌 HDMI - cables and adapters are required, the length of the wire is limited.
Benefits of Wi-Fi Direct for LG TV:
- ⚡ Speed up to
250 Mbps(enough for Full HD without lags); - 🔒 Secure connection via protocol WPA2;
- 🎮 Supports transmission of not only video, but also audio, as well as control from the TV remote control;
- 📱 Works even if Wi-Fi is disabled on the laptop (access point mode).
However, there are some nuances: on some models LG (for example, series UK6200 (2018) Wi-Fi Direct can only work with mobile devices, not PCs. You can check compatibility in the TV menu: Settings → Network → Wi-Fi DirectIf the item is missing, your model does not support the function.
Preparing your LG TV: Enabling Wi-Fi Direct
Before connecting devices, you need to activate Wi-Fi Direct mode on the TV itself. The interface may differ slightly depending on the version. webOS (from 3.0 to 23), but the general algorithm is the same.
Turn on the TV and press the button
Settings(gear) on the remote control.Go to the section
Network → Wi-Fi Direct.Activate the slider Wi-Fi Direct (should turn green).
Select
Device Settingsand set the TV's visibility for other gadgets.Remember or write down network name (For example,
DIRECT-LG-WebOS-TV-1234) and password (if required).
On some models (eg, LG OLED C1After Wi-Fi Direct is enabled, the TV automatically starts searching for devices. If the laptop screen doesn't appear in the list, restart both devices and try again.

Setting up a laptop on Windows 10/11
On a Windows PC, the connection is made via the function Projecting onto this computer (for Windows 10 version 1803 and later) or third-party utilities like MiracastHowever, Wi-Fi Direct will require manual network configuration.
Method 1: Via "Settings" (recommended)
Open
Settings → Network and Internet → Wi-Fi.Click
Manage known networks → Add new network.Enter the TV network name (eg.
DIRECT-LG-TV-5678) and password (if any).In the section
Security typeselect WPA2-Personal.Connect to the network. Once successfully connected, a notification will appear on your TV.
Method 2: Via the command line (for experienced users)
If Windows doesn't see your TV's network, try connecting manually:
netsh wlan connect name="DIRECT-LG-TV-1234" ssid="DIRECT-LG-TV-1234"
Replace DIRECT-LG-TV-1234 to the actual network name of your TV. If it asks for a password, add the key key=your_password.
What to do if Windows says "We couldn't connect to the network"
Check if the Wi-Fi adapter on your laptop is enabled (indicator on the F2/F12 key).
Update your wireless adapter driver through Device Manager.
Disable your VPN or firewall (they may be blocking a direct connection).
Please restart your TV and laptop and then try again.

Solutions to common errors
Even with proper setup, problems can still arise. Here are the most common ones and how to fix them:
⚠️ Attention: If the TV LG If your laptop isn't visible in the list of Wi-Fi Direct devices, check if your TV model supports PC connectivity. Some TVs (e.g., the LJ550V) work only with smartphones.
| Error |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| "Unable to connect" | Incorrect password or security type | Check the network settings on your TV (it should be WPA2) |
| The screen flickers or slows down | Weak signal or high resolution | Reduce the resolution to 1280×720 or move the laptop closer to the TV |
| No sound | Setting up audio output | Select TV as the output device in the sound settings |
| "Device not supported" | Outdated TV firmware | Update your TV software via Settings → General → About TV |
If after connection the image is transmitted with artifacts:
- 🔌 Check if other wireless devices (microwaves, cordless phones) are interfering.
- 📶 Change the Wi-Fi channel on your TV manually (select the channel in the network settings)
6or11- they are less busy). - 🔄 Disable the power-saving mode of your Wi-Fi adapter in Windows Device Manager.
Alternative ways to connect a laptop to an LG TV
If Wi-Fi Direct doesn't work or isn't supported by your model, consider these alternatives:
- 🔗 HDMI cable — reliable, but requires a physical connection. For new MacBook you will need an adapter
USB-C → HDMI. - 📶 Miracast - works on Windows 10/11 (turned on via
Win + K). - 🌐 Via a router - if both devices are connected to the same network, you can use DLNA (for media files) or Steam Link (for games).
- 📱 Mirror applications — ApowerMirror or TeamViewer (suitable for presentations).
For gamers the best option is pair mode through NVIDIA GameStream (if the laptop has an NVIDIA graphics card) or Steam LinkThese technologies are optimized for minimal latency, which is critical for shooters and racing games.

Does the 2016 LG TV support Wi-Fi Direct?
Models LG 2016 (series UH6100, UH7700 etc.) support Wi-Fi Direct, but:
- ⚠️ For transfer only media files (photo, video), not the entire screen.
- ⚠️ Maximum resolution —
1280×720. - ⚠️ Installation of proprietary software may be required LG TV Plus.
To duplicate your screen, use Miracast or HDMI.
